Polyketide therapeutic programmes
Biotica develops its therapeutic programmes to preclinical proof-of-concept and then seeks a partner with therapeutic area and development expertise. Usually partnerships include access for the partner to Biotica’s compound library, a research collaboration using the novoPT technology and a license to develop and commercialise resulting compounds.

Lead optimisation collaborations
Biotica undertakes lead optimisation collaborations around a partner’s polyketide of interest. These usually include a research collaboration and a license to develop and market resulting compounds.

Biotica’s novoPT technology can increase discovery productivity through its ability to optimise leads that might otherwise be considered poor starting points. Natural products identified through library screening may be discarded due to their intractability to conventional chemistry. novoPT generates a library of differentiated derivatives with drug-like properties, enabling access to both chemistries and targets that are often neglected in drug discovery.

Current partnerships
Biotica has succesful ongoing collaborations with two companies:

  • with Wyeth on the nPT-mTOR programme of novel rapamycin analogues
  • with GlaxoSmithKline on the nPT-ery programme of novel erythromycin analogues
